Just how do I understand when my pipelines have burst?


Changing water stress


Pipes do not simply burst in a day. You may have observed that your kitchen faucet or shower does not run instantly when you transform the faucet. It may stop for a few secs and then blast you with even more force than typical.
In various other instances, the water might seem regular at first, after that decrease in pressure after a couple of seconds.

Damp wall surfaces as well as water discolorations


Before a pipeline bursts, it will certainly leak, many times. If this relentless dripping goes undetected, the leak might graduate right into a vast laceration in your pipe. One simple means to avoid this emergency is to watch out for damp walls ad water discolorations. These water stains will certainly lead you right to the leakage.

Puddles under pipes as well as sinks


When a pipeline bursts, the outflow forms a pool. It might appear that the pool is expanding in dimension, and also no matter how many times you mop the puddle, in a few mins, there's an additional one waiting to be cleansed. Often, you may not be able to trace the puddle to any type of noticeable pipelines. This is an indicator to call a professional plumber.

Untraceable trickling noises


Pipeline ruptureds can take place in the most unpleasant areas, like within concrete, inside wall surfaces, or under sinks. When your house goes silent, you may be able to hear an irritatingly persistent dripping noise. Even after you've checked your shower head and cooking area faucet, the dripping may continue.
Dear reader, the dripping may be originating from a pipeline inside your walls. There isn't much you can do about that, except inform a professional plumber.

Shut off the Water


When water freezes, it increases in quantity by regarding 9 percent. And it expands with significant pressure: The stress inside pipelines might go from 40 extra pounds per square inch to 40,000 psi! No pipeline can hold that much pressure, so it breaks open. The break may take place where the ice kinds, yet regularly, it happens where water stress discovers a vulnerable point in the pipe. That might be inches or perhaps feet from the icy location. Locate the water shutoff valve and also shut off the water to avoid more damage. You could likewise require to shut off the electricity as well, depending upon where the leakages happens and exactly how big it is.

Infected water


Many individuals presume a burst pipeline is a one-way electrical outlet. Rather the contrary. As water flows out of the hole or gash in your plumbing system, impurities discover their way in.
Your water might be polluted from the source, so if you can, examine if your water container has any kind of issues. Nevertheless, if your drinking water is provided as well as purified by the local government, you ought to call your plumber instantly if you see or scent anything funny in your water.

What do I do when I detect a ruptured pipe?


Your water meter will certainly continue to run also while your water wastes. To reduce your losses, locate the primary controls and also transform the supply off. The water mains are an above-ground framework at the edge of your building.



What are the signs of a pipe bursts?


Many home owners cannot detect pipe bursts until they see water flooding in their houses. But why should you wait for this situation, when there are other signs to identify and locate the pipe burst.



These are the common signs of a pipe burst and knowing these signs early can keep you away from ‘troubled waters’!


Water Pressure Problems:


When the water pressure in the taps dip, it is a sign of the trouble that is looming large. Low pressure in the taps indicates a problem as a pipe burst affects water flow in the pipes. If your pipes have burst, water will be diverted to the hole rather than the faucet – which lowers your water’s pressure.


Wall Stains:


Stains mostly occur for various reasons. However, large stains on the walls usually indicate that your pipes have issues. In most cases, those stains indicate where the pipe had burst. Wall stains are the most helpful as they lead you to the location where burst might have happened or is about to happen.


Water Odor and Discoloration:


If you notice discolored water flowing from the faucet, it is a signal of pipe leak. Sometimes, brownish water indicates that your pipes have rust. Leaking also adds odor. How? When your pipes have leaks, it is tough for the plumbing system to push sewage into the mainline hence causing the foul odor.

Stop the Water Supply:


If you suspect that the pipe has broken, run to the water main and turn off the stop tap. Check it under the kitchen or where your main supply pipe links to your house. You should always ensure that every member in your family can locate it in case of emergencies.


Drain Faucets:


After you have switched off the main water valve, drain all the pipes by running cold water from all the faucets. Also, ensure that you flush every toilet at least once. Then, shut the water heater off and go back to each faucet. Run the hot water to drain the water supply. The leak will automatically stop as there will be no more supply of water.


Locate the Broken Pipe:


To prevent further damage, try to locate the spot where the pipe had burst. The burst location will determine what you’ll have to do next. If it is a small crack, you can first patch it up to fix the issue for a while. However, if the burst has occurred on the main water pipe, repair it carefully regardless of the size or cause of break.



If the leaking had occurred for quite some time, enter the house carefully. Pay much attention to the ceilings- if they appear to have bulged, it is an indication that they’re holding a load of water and can cave in anytime.
